The usual situation
The collective works. The digital communication doesn’t.
The website is hard to update — it always depends on someone. Meetings are called via WhatsApp. Documents live on Google Drive without anyone having decided that. Photos are on someone’s Instagram who may no longer be in the collective.
It’s not bad will. It’s that nobody designed the system.
